When it comes to choosing the right green pool tile for your home, it’s important to consider the overall style of your space. If you have a modern or contemporary home, opt for clean-lined green pool tiles with a glossy finish.

If your home has more of a traditional aesthetic, go for green pool tiles with an intricate design or texture. No matter what style you choose, make sure the green pool tiles you select to complement the rest of your space.

How to Care for the Tile Once Installed?

It is important to take care of your tile once it is installed. Here are some tips on how to care for the tile:

-Clean the tile regularly with a mild soap and water solution.

-Avoid using harsh chemicals or cleaners on the tile.

-Seal the tile periodically to protect it from dirt and stains.

-Repair any chips or cracks in the tile as soon as possible.
